Hi All,
just landed back in Victoria after performing during the 2011 Boyup Brook festival. And what a festival!!!! The line up this year was brilliant with artists such as Troy Cassar-Daly, Felicity Urquart, Pete Denehy, Graham Rodger and Amber Joy, just to mention a few. I went over as a poetry guest with Melanie hall and Susie Carcery.

Bush Poet's Breakfasts were held every morning with the Harvey Dickson morming attracting somewhere around 700 to 800 people and the Sunday morning attracting a conservative guess of over 2000 people, a bigger crowd who watched Troy and Felicity and co on the Sunday arvo!!!

The quality of the poetry presented by the WA poets, not only in the comp., but at all the walk up events, was nothing short of first class. I have had the privilege to judge several National and state championships and I say with no reservations, that the standard was equal to anything I have witnessed! The quality, the delivery, the pure dedication of all the competitors and performers was something to savour, so congratulations to all, and in particular Irene and Brian Langley for reviving the WA championships and hopefully present the WA poets with many more years of quality competition.

Congratulations to all winners, place getters and a lot of poets who came so close to becoming either. Look out East Coast, there is so much untapped talent in the West that you will all be fighting even harder in the future to get your hands on a trophy!!!
